The Lab/Pharmacy Technician Assistant is responsible for performing consistently and with accuracy all in-house lab-work for patients as well as being responsible for sending and receiving outside diagnostics. The Lab/Pharmacy Technician is responsible for preparing all new prescription medications for in-house patients, out-patients, and refill all medications for patients upon request, including calling in & faxing prescription requests.

Responsibilities of this role Include:

  • Be primarily responsible for all shipping of lab samples and medications to outside laboratories.
  • Maintain and care for all in-hospital laboratory equipment, including running controls.
  • Be primarily responsible for distribution and follow up of all incoming labwork from outside labs.
  • Attaching all in-house and outside diagnostics to the associated clinical record, and maintain EzyVet’s worklist.
  • Stock and maintain adequate inventory for all lab supplies and products, as well as prescription medication to be dispensed to patients.
  • Once provided the requisition sheet or order and blood / tissue / fluid sample, run requested in-house lab work accurately.
  • Prepare medications and prescriptions for dispensing as directed by the doctor. 
  • When provided order from doctor, call outside pharmacies for filling of prescriptions for patients.
  • Daily, upon receipt of sample and lab order form, package and ship to appropriate outside laboratory.
